Service scope
Review installation space, handling access, electrical supply, cooling water, gas, exhaust, grounding, and other project-specific interfaces before final site preparation.
Confirm interlocks, alarm logic, emergency procedures, operating roles, and the documentation needed for the planned installation and start-up sequence.
Define the planned checks, records, training scope, trial material or dummy tooling, and acceptance responsibilities before the handover discussion.
Before contacting support
These inputs help identify the right next question. They do not replace a site inspection, process trial, or project-specific acceptance review.
01Equipment model or project reference and planned installation location
02Available electrical, cooling-water, gas, exhaust, lifting, and floor-loading information
03Site access constraints, safety rules, installation schedule, and responsible contacts
04Planned documentation language, training needs, trial tooling, and acceptance checklist
